Block 398,043
Block Hash
5ed2e9f72f2887da8a3e7ce4f056da1170ca3666e6343ad343feaac8e224c4f1
Previous Block Hash
d9d008b216fae7a8a328bac108246e50b13e1db7630b57454b2d94ec95726b85
Mined
Transactions
3
Difficulty
27.54 M
Size
625 bytes
Transactions (3)
1 input, 1 output
62,500.00452
PEPE
1 input, 2 outputs
1,075,446.75128574
PEPE
1 input, 2 outputs
488,805.53292
PEPE